A top militant of Hizbul Mujahideen was on Monday gunned down in a fierce encounter in Doda district, the latest in the string of successes for security forces in Jammu and Kashmir.

Mohd Hanief Bhat alias Irfan, the self-styled "deputy divisional commander" of Hizbul, was killed during the operation by army and police launched in Nandani area of Dessa belt after a tip off, official sources said.
Bhat was active in Jammu region since 1994, they said.
On October nine, Pakistani militant Zaheer Ahmad alias "Pasha", the "chief commander" of Jaish-e-Mohammad, was killed at Warpora village of Sopore.
A day later, top Lashkar-e-Toiba commander Moeen was killed in an encounter in Pulwama district.
